Detailed Coverage:

Interarch Building Solutions Ltd. experienced a substantial 12% rise in its stock price on Friday, November 7, driven by exceptionally strong financial results for the September quarter. The company announced its results after market hours on Thursday.

The September quarter saw Interarch Building Solutions' revenue climb by 52% year-on-year to ₹491.1 crore. Earnings Before Interest, Tax, Depreciation, and Amortisation (EBITDA) saw an even more impressive jump of 65%, reaching ₹41.7 crore compared to ₹25.3 crore in the same period last year. The company's EBITDA margin also expanded by 70 basis points to 8.5% from 7.8%.

As of July 31, 2025, Interarch Building Solutions maintained a robust order book totaling ₹1,695 crore. In a recent interaction, Manish Garg of Interarch Building Solutions reaffirmed the company's growth guidance of 17.5% for the financial year 2026, expressing optimism about strong ground-level demand and further margin improvements.

The stock has been a strong performer, trading up 12.6% at ₹2,462 and having gained 24% over the past month. Since its listing in August 2024 at an IPO price of ₹900, the stock has nearly tripled its value.

Impact: This positive news significantly boosts investor confidence in Interarch Building Solutions, highlighting its operational efficiency and growth potential. The strong financial performance, robust order book, and positive outlook are likely to sustain or further enhance the stock's upward trajectory. The company's ability to grow revenue and improve margins, coupled with strong demand, signals good financial health and future prospects for the building solutions sector. Impact Rating: 7/10

Difficult Terms: EBITDA: Earnings Before Interest, Tax, Depreciation, and Amortisation. This metric shows a company's operating performance before considering financing costs, taxes, and non-cash accounting charges. It provides a cleaner view of the company's core operational profitability. EBITDA Margin: This is EBITDA expressed as a percentage of revenue. It indicates how much profit a company generates from its sales after accounting for operational costs, but before interest, taxes, depreciation, and amortization. An expanding margin suggests improved efficiency or pricing power. Basis Points: A unit of measure equal to 1/100th of a percentage point. For example, 70 basis points is equal to 0.70%. Order Book: The total value of confirmed orders that a company has received from customers for goods or services that have not yet been delivered or completed. It serves as an indicator of future revenue. Growth Guidance: A forecast provided by a company regarding its expected future performance, typically in terms of revenue or profit growth, for a specified period.
